John MOULTON
Biography



"John Moulton, Lieutenant (called 'The Giant'), son of John, m. Mar. 23, 1666, Lydia, daughter of Anthony Taylor, and remained on the homestead. She d. in 1729, set. 83 y. (rec. of D. M.)
Their children were,

Martha, b. Nov. 16, 1666, m. Humphrey Perkins, of Hampton, and had eight or more children.

John, b. May 30, 1669, in. Rebecca Smith, and d. Apr. 1, 1740, a?t. 70 y. 10 m. 1 d.

Lydia, b. July 13, 1671, and d. July 13, 1678, set. 7y.

Daniel, b. Jan. 16, 1674, m. Mary , and d. Jan. 14, 1718, set. 43 y. 11 m. 28 d.

James, b. July 29, 1675, m. Dorothy Clements.

Anna, b. Mar. 2, 1679, m. Caleb Marston, Nov. 12, 1695.

Lydia, b. July 19, 1681, m. Thomas Marston.

Nathan, b. , m. Sarah Keaser.

David, b. , m. Sarah Leavitt.

Jacob, b. June 21, 1688, m. Sarah Smith, and d. Mar. 7, 1751, set. 62 y. 8 m. 16 d.

Rachel, b. Oct. 4, 1690, m. May 21, 1718, Jabez Smith, and d. June 8, 1758, set. 67 y. 7 m. 23 d.


A genealogical register of some of the descendants of John Moulton, of Hampton and of Joseph Moulton of Portsmouth
by Moulton, Thomas, 1810-1888
Published 1873
